The Facebook Feed Embed feature lets you display your Facebook Page timeline directly on your public Counselling Network profile. It’s a simple way to show your latest updates without having to copy and paste posts in multiple places.
It’s helpful if you want your profile to feel active and current.
Common reasons counsellors use it:
You post updates on Facebook (availability, articles, reminders, events)
You want clients to see you’re active and approachable
You want to “post once” and have it appear in more than one place

Follow these steps:
Open the Facebook Page Plugin tool (Facebook’s official embed builder)
Paste the link to your Facebook Page (not your personal profile)
Facebook will generate an embed code
Copy the full embed code
Go to your Counselling Network dashboard:
Edit Profile → Social Media → Facebook Feed
Paste the code into the Facebook Feed box
Click Save
Use Preview / View Public Profile to check how it looks

Try these quick checks:
Make sure you pasted the embed code for a Facebook Page, not a personal profile
Confirm your Page is public and has at least one recent post
Try saving again and refreshing your public profile
Some browsers or privacy extensions can block Facebook embeds (try another browser/device)
